Is My Data Safe During Indianapolis Medical Equipment Disposal?

Under HIPAA 45 CFR §164.312 requirements, electronic protected health information on disposed devices must be rendered irretrievable. Per NIST SP 800-88 Rev. 1 guidelines, media sanitization requires verification of purge-level overwrite or physical destruction—STS provides certified destruction meeting both standards.
